>>> I was arguing that opEquals (and co.) should *not* be const. IMO it
>>> would be a huge problem if they were.
>>
>> why? For what purpose do you need to change an object during comparison?
>
> The comparison may involve comparing a sub-object that is lazily  
> created. It could also involve computing a cached perfect hash for  
> faster comparison, requiring memoization.

Neither of these are required for opEquals to work.  They are  
optimizations.
